
It's good to be bad… Embark on an all-new DC/LEGO® adventure by becoming the best villain the universe has seen. Players will create and play as an all-new super-villain throughout the game, unleashing mischievous antics and wreaking havoc in an action-packed story.

The game is mostly fun. 95% of the game is simple as can be. Puzzles are easy. Fights are easy. Levels are easy. Most of the tasks are easy, if somewhat monotonous. BUT, some of the boss battles, and some stages in the game as well...will leave you absolutely clueless on how to get through them. Some of the hidden collectibles will be challenging as well, but at least they provide in-game clues for those. There are some glitches, that apparently are known but have and never will be fixed, that can leave me so frustrated, I'm ready to quit the game and uninstall it...right now it's the Black Adam vs Shazam boss fight...according to the internet, it's supposed to take 10-15 minutes to beat the level and takes maybe 3-4 cycles of combat to win. I was on my 12th or 13th cycle, over a half-hour into the fight, and Shazam just won't take the damage he's supposed to take. It's nothing I'm doing, I'm doing what I'm supposed to do...but the glitchy fight won't end. Maybe the next time I start the game, it'll work fine...but it's going to force me to go through the whole level again just to find out. I didn't have these issues on previous LEGO TravelersTales games, and I have them all. This is the first one that has me annoyed to the point of not playing it anymore. MOST of the glitches the AI mentions are on consoles, but I'm playing on a PC, so zero solutions have helped. There have been other issues in some boss fights, but most of them are just the level of difficulty at trying to figure out how the thing works, after spending dozens of hours where I'm not challenged in the least to do tasks, the whiplash I get sometimes at how much difficulty they pile on to some fights is annoying. It's a fantastic game...when it works the way it's supposed to...so many DC characters, it's fun to unlock them, and they all have a plethora of special abilities which puts this game light years past the original Batman game, and several levels beyond Batman 3...but the number of glitches and the number of times I've had to stop playing to look up how to get to this map marker, or get through this boss fight, or figure out which character I need to use because the game gives you ZERO clues...they're starting to add up. I recommend the game...but know what you're getting into. There will be incredibly frustrating moments, and possibly rage quitting. You've been warned.

I'm coming off of the previous DC Lego games, aka Lego Batman 1, 2, and 3. This game is a mess. If you play Lego Batman 1 and play the Villain side, thinking it may be similar, it's not. At first the Gotham Levels with Joker and other Gotham Villains are fun, but quickly they shove the Crime syndicate, other universe BS, and other characters nobody really cares about. The levels quickly start feeling like a SLOG to play. I didn't even finish the story, I got close I think but I couldn't force myself to play any longer. I'm trying to get excited for the new LEGO BATMAN Legacy of the Dark Knight which is why I'm playing through the series, but if you were doing the same or just wanting to try it, please don't. It's not fun, feels messy, and the custom character is whatever. I try not to be negative when playing games, but this game just hurt me.
